In this episode, Michelle delves into pivotal developments influencing Southeast Asia's economic landscape. She begins with an overview of top stories, focusing on Indonesia's potential journey towards joining BRICS and the resulting economic, social, and geopolitical impacts. The episode examines Indonesia's new forestry carbon trading program, exploring its market implications and significance for sustainable development. Michelle also discusses Oracle's investment in a data center on Batam Island, highlighting its economic impacts and potential to enhance regional technological infrastructure.
